What Features Define the Best Electric Zero Turn Lawn Mower?
The best electric zero turn lawn mowers are defined by several key features that enhance their performance, efficiency, and user experience.
- Battery Life: A long-lasting battery is crucial for electric zero turn mowers, allowing users to mow larger areas without needing to recharge. High-capacity lithium-ion batteries are favored for their longevity and ability to maintain power throughout the mowing process.
- Cutting Width: The cutting width determines how much grass can be cut in a single pass, impacting mowing efficiency. Wider cutting decks typically range from 42 to 60 inches, allowing users to cover more ground quickly, which is particularly beneficial for larger yards.
- Speed and Maneuverability: The ability to adjust speed and navigate tight corners is essential for achieving a well-manicured lawn. Electric zero turn mowers offer precise steering and quick acceleration, enabling users to easily maneuver around obstacles.
- Durability and Build Quality: A robust construction ensures that the mower can withstand regular use and the elements. High-quality materials, such as steel frames and reinforced decks, contribute to the mower’s longevity and performance over time.
- User-Friendly Controls: Intuitive controls make it easier for users to operate the mower effectively. Features such as ergonomic levers, easy-to-read displays, and adjustable settings enhance comfort and reduce the learning curve for new users.
- Noise Level: Electric mowers are generally quieter than their gas counterparts, contributing to a more pleasant mowing experience. Low noise levels allow for mowing during early morning or late evening without disturbing neighbors.
- Maintenance Requirements: Electric zero turn mowers typically require less maintenance than gas mowers, as they do not need oil changes or fuel system upkeep. This ease of maintenance can save time and reduce costs over the mower’s lifespan.
- Environmental Impact: Electric mowers produce no emissions during operation, making them an eco-friendly choice for lawn care. Their reduced carbon footprint appeals to environmentally conscious consumers looking to maintain their lawns sustainably.
How Does Battery Life Impact Performance in Electric Zero Turn Lawn Mowers?
Power consistency refers to how well the mower maintains its speed and cutting power throughout its runtime. A battery that delivers consistent power ensures that the mower performs effectively, even when cutting through thicker grass or uneven terrain.
Charging time impacts how quickly the mower can be ready for use again. If a mower takes a long time to charge, it may limit the user’s ability to perform tasks efficiently, especially if the battery runs out during operation.
Battery capacity, typically measured in amp-hours (Ah), indicates how much energy the battery can store. A higher capacity allows for longer operation periods, which is vital for users with extensive lawn areas to cover.
Battery durability affects how many charge cycles the battery can undergo before its performance degrades. A durable battery not only ensures reliable performance over time but also reduces the need for frequent replacements, making the mower more economical in the long run.
Why is Cutting Width an Essential Factor in Electric Zero Turn Lawn Mowers?
Cutting width is a critical consideration when selecting an electric zero turn lawn mower. This measurement directly influences how efficiently you can mow your lawn, ultimately affecting the speed and quality of your lawn care.
Key reasons why cutting width matters:
-
Time Efficiency: A wider cutting deck allows you to cover more ground in fewer passes. For example, a mower with a 60-inch cutting width can complete a lawn faster than one with only a 42-inch width, making it ideal for larger properties.
-
Maneuverability: While larger cutting widths are beneficial for speed, they can be less maneuverable in tight spaces. Assess your yard’s layout; narrower decks are useful for navigating obstacles like trees, flower beds, or fences.
-
Grass Health: The cutting width also affects how well you can maintain grass health. A wider mower might require you to regularly alternate mowing patterns to avoid damaging the same area repetitively, ensuring even growth and avoiding soil compaction.
-
Clipping Dispersal: Wider decks can distribute grass clippings more effectively, reducing the chances of clumping, which can smother the lawn and lead to unhealthy patches.
Selecting an appropriate cutting width based on your yard size and terrain is vital for achieving a well-manicured lawn.

How Do Electric Zero Turn Lawn Mowers Compare to Traditional Gas Models?
| Feature | Electric Zero Turn | Gas Zero Turn |
|---|---|---|
| Power Source | Powered by batteries, offering a cleaner energy source. | Utilizes gasoline, which can be less efficient and more polluting. |
| Maintenance | Requires less maintenance, mainly battery care and blade sharpening. | Needs regular oil changes, filter replacements, and spark plug checks. |
| Noise Level | Quieter operation, making it suitable for residential areas. | Typically louder, which may disturb neighbors during use. |
| Cost | Initial purchase price can be higher, but lower operating costs over time. | Generally cheaper upfront, but higher long-term fuel and maintenance costs. |
| Battery Life | Typically offers 1-3 hours of operation before needing a recharge. | Unlimited runtime as long as fuel is available. |
| Charging Time | Usually requires 4-8 hours to fully charge. | N/A |
| Cutting Performance | Generally provides a consistent cut but may struggle in thick grass. | Often delivers superior cutting power and speed in tough conditions. |
| Weight and Maneuverability | Tends to be lighter, allowing for easier maneuvering. | Generally heavier, which can affect maneuverability. |
| Environmental Impact | Zero emissions during operation, contributing to better air quality. | Produces emissions and contributes to air pollution. |
